5/10
forced L
SnoopyStyle27 May 2022
Jane (Sophie Turner) is suicidal and leaving treatment despite still spiraling out of control. Her plane crashes in the freezing mountains. She and fellow passenger Paul Hart (Corey Hawkins) are the only survivors.

The movie needs to get to the plane crash sooner. The treatment center opening section is unnecessary and unnecessarily artsy. All that can be revealed later with flashbacks and conversations. When she actually reveals her story, it's underwhelming. The opening is not adding much anyways. Her freak-out at the airport is more informative and more compelling. The plane crash could be better. It would be more logical if the plane crash happens when they are sitting side by side at the back of the plane. The logic is so false that I do wonder if he's a ghost. There is a lot that could be better. Their survival skills are trash although she has one great excuse. One would expect her character to be annoying but he's the annoying one. The locations are cool as long as they use the real locations. There is plenty of survival action but they are generally not filmed well. I don't know much about Mark Pellington but he doesn't seem to be a big action guy. This probably needs to be an action-packed survival film and they definitely need to get rid of the L word. They struggle to get that central premise through and that is what ultimately sinks this movie. I don't buy their connection and the L feels forced.

5/10
This was a television series?
Top_Dawg_Critic23 June 2022
Warning: Spoilers
You'd think they would take bits and pieces from the ten episode series (which I never saw or knew existed) to fill in the 108 min runtime, but instead, you get 80% NatGeo repetitive scenic shots of mountains and landscapes, and 20% story that was riddled with plot and technical issues, and melodramatics with sappy dialogue and just as sappy score.

For that matter, with all the negative feedback for the series, why did the writers and producers feel the need to punish audiences with the same boring story? This may have worked as a short film, but the ridiculously repetitive scenes full of filler and lack of any real interesting and suspenseful substance, made the 108 min runtime feel endless. Why even have the entire Life House portion at the beginning, when it was irrelevant to the rest of the story? If it was to portray her mental health issues, there was plenty of time during the long boring survival treks to bring that conversation up. Clearly terrible writing and poor directing is what failed this film, and that's too bad, because in the right hands, the concept actually had potential.

To make matters worse, there were so many parts that were lazily written and dumb, it became cringeworthy quickly. For example, even a professional mountain/cliff climber would barely attempt the unbelievable treks that conveniently ended on the edges of all these cliffs and the climbs downwards. And no matter how dumb you are, why would anyone leave a crash site? So what if a storm is coming, the fuselage is still the best protection, with supplies right there to use and the best chance for survival, let alone the best chance for a rescue. To not know where you are and start walking without rhyme or reason, is just lazy and dumb writing.

Don't waste your time with this sloth, even if you've seen the series and are the few who enjoyed it, I promise you this film will bore you. It's a very generous 5/10 from me, all going to the excellent cinematography and fairly decent performances by Turner and Hawkins.

3/10
Even the stupid survive
russelldresearch9 December 2022
Warning: Spoilers
Sophie Turner and Corey Hawkins both perform fairly well and are very watchable, but I can't be bothered to give a broader review because their characters are so stupid and the script and dialogue are daft. This story isn't credible in several places, and the two main characters seem oblivious to the most obvious things to do - like stay at the crash site (given the location) rather than wander off across miles of mountain peaks and snow. Then there's the part at the start where Jane (ST) breaks into the pharmacy at the mental health agency she is in - if it was that easy, there would be no drugs left in the pharmacy! But the most annoying part of all is when Jane and Paul haul themselves into a cave after an avalanche. They are very hungry, cold and fatigued; they're battered and bruised from the plane crash; and Paul has broken ribs, and then gets a panic attack. Yet they have oxycodone and fentanyl tablets with them, which would reduce much of the pain caused by all of the above problems, and allow them to move on - but they don't consider these pills as having any use other than suicide if things get really bad for them! If they both popped a few of those opioid tabs, they could probably have skipped and danced down the rest of the mountain to the nearest town, and we could have ended with a nice sex scene or something. But no. Unless you like laughing in disbelief and shouting at the screen, avoid this movie.

5/10
Survived and Confused
imlivingamber4 January 2024
Warning: Spoilers
I really wanted to love this film. I love the idea of someone who is suicidal, who has decided they want to die, be put in a situation where they must fight to survive. The execution was really unclear until the end, and then you realize... oh the storytelling is lack luster. There were moments where I thought, maybe they are playing on the psychological instability of the main character, Jane. Where you're not entirely capable of trusting the storytelling. I will say, a lot of the cinematography, does indicate this. What comes to mind is when Jane is in the lavatory as the plane is crashing, to when Jane is hit by an avalanche, and she repeats the words "help me." The film struggled to tell a story and a message. Anything that it told felt very bare and disconnected. It was very I'm telling you the story, not showing you it. There are a lot of holes in the story. We don't learn nearly anything about Paul, other than it's Christmas time, he's going somewhere, he wants to survive and his mom died from cancer when he was a kid. Also, add in the stereotypical male smitten with female lead and that about sums up Paul. Which is INSANE to have an actor like Corey play a character with little substance. Corey definitely added the depth the character needed considering the circumstances the character was put in. But, we have no context about his life whatsoever. What is his career? I thought, for sure, we would get more context as to why he knows what to do to survive, or to set his bone, or even know that a river will lead to a road. To make some of this make sense. The fact that this man has broken ribs, more than likely is internally bleeding, and the opioids are only seen as a method of suicide is really hard to watch. I'm glad, at some point they come into play as medicine. Not to mention, Paul's death is because he lost his footing on the side of a cliff... out of all the things. We don't see the effects of being hungry, or dehydrated. Something that would effect both of their stamina past the first day. This is why I was so convinced that this was more a psychological journey, than a realistic take on surviving the wilderness. They do make the film largely about the perception and mental state of both Jane and Paul. (Also, Jane and Paul, come on... out of all the names, yall really did that. I know it's based on a book, but damn, can't get more generic). The idea of someone who was so willing to fight for their life, feeling hopeless and the hopeless finding strength in being a partner to help someone else survive. But, the depth to the characters was short and narrow. There is no depth. There is a layer, and that is all these characters are. That and the transformation isn't really felt, it's clear there was a change and a shift, but not a clear why.

I'm giving it a 5 star, besides all of the holes in the film making because, it still did make me feel something. I really wanted to love it because I love the concept. I did become attached and wanted them both to survive. I even love the idea that this character came out a survivor and found a value for life through the struggle to survive. It just wasn't executed well. There was a lot of potential, but there wasn't a lot of attention to detail, and that's what makes a story great. Details to the characters and of course, the actual plot- being they are surviving on a mountain range. Research on what that means, what that requires and find a logical path for them to find safety.

Others mention the wolf scene being unrealistic, and I have to agree. I, once again, thought this moment was meant to be symbolic. You know, she is using the shattered glass she used to cut, to protect herself. I believe it is meant to be the final boss, in a sense, that she faces in her will to live. If only, the movie leaned into magical realism a little, or a little bit of a created world instead of the real world. You know, where they can make up their own rules, but they didn't go there and it would've made a difference. To make it surreal verses realistic.

Overall, it looks like the quality would be up there with the cinemas, it's not. It reminds me of a hallmark movie, only moody and edgy, and able to talk about dark subject matters.
